照猫画虎,附上原文:https://docs.docker.com/userguide/dockerizing/?便于理解。 ? ?1. 一个Hello world 后台服务 $?sudo?docker?run?-d?ubuntu:14.04?/bin/sh?-c?"while?true;?do?echo?hel...
分类:
其他好文 时间:
2014-11-19 02:27:16
阅读次数:
268
最近的项目中使用到了推送,第一次搞推送,遇到了不少坑,所以记录下来。
参考:手把手教你做IOS推送
首先是一些基础知识
APNS的推送机制
首先我们看一下苹果官方给出的对iOS推送机制的解释。如下图
Provider就是我们自己程序的后台服务器,APNS是Apple Push Notification Service的缩写,也就是苹果的推送...
分类:
移动开发 时间:
2014-11-18 09:10:32
阅读次数:
305
前言 又是好久没写博客了~~~,越来越懒,越来越没有目标了!正文 最近总是有人问如何通过Silverlight上传图片并保存的后台服务器?众所周知,Silverlight是客户端程序,不能很好与服务器进行“沟通”,上传图片的方法呢大致都是通过以下流程: 1、客户端获取图片-->2、转换能够传输...
分类:
Web程序 时间:
2014-11-15 16:46:02
阅读次数:
237
android开发之Intent.setFlags()_让Android点击通知栏信息后返回正在运行的程序在应用里使用了后台服务,并且在通知栏推送了消息,希望点击这个消息回到activity,结果总是存在好几个同样的activity,就算要返回的activity正在前台,点击消息后也会重新打开一个一...
分类:
移动开发 时间:
2014-11-15 11:15:28
阅读次数:
182
在后台服务中添加程序日志记录可以跟踪代码运行时轨迹,作为日后审计的依据;并且担当集成开发环境中的调试器的作用,向文件打印代码的调试信息;同时规划化输出的日志文件,便于和其他相关人员交流分析使用。本规定C++ 后台服务项目必须使用。
日志文件
日志文件按应用需求功能分为访问日志和应用日志和系统日志。日志文件统一命名格式如下:服务名称.应用类型.时间.索引。中间采用点符号(.)分割。
服务名称:...
分类:
其他好文 时间:
2014-11-13 20:49:36
阅读次数:
268
守护进程模式 使用python开发后台服务程序的时候,每次修改代码之后都需要重启服务才能生效比较麻烦。看了一下Python开源的Web框架(Django、Flask等)都有自己的自动加载模块功能(autoreload.py),都是通过subprocess模式创建子进程,主进程作为守护进程,子进程中....
分类:
编程语言 时间:
2014-11-13 01:46:10
阅读次数:
246
这个内存对齐问题,居然影响到了sizeof(struct)的结果值。突然想到了之前写的一个API库里,有个API是向后台服务程序发送socket请求。其中的socket数据包是一个结构体。在发送socket之前,会检测数据的长度;服务端接收到数据后也会检测长度。如果说内存对齐问题影响到了结构体的si...
分类:
编程语言 时间:
2014-11-12 22:36:33
阅读次数:
564
这几天试着搭了个持续集成环境,我使用的是Jenkins,它的前身是Hadson,因为被Oracle收购了,所以换个名字继续开源,这个有点像MySQL。
持续集成总是跟敏捷开发什么的搞在一起,显得很高大上,其实它就是一个后台服务+web管理配置页面,它可以自动化(定时或事件触发)地执行某项任务,比如编译程序、打包程序、自动发布等等。这个在web开发或者大项目的多人合作上面很有帮助。...
分类:
其他好文 时间:
2014-11-11 14:30:51
阅读次数:
202
Service组件在android开发中经常遇到,其经常作为后台服务,需要始终保持运行,负责处理一些必要(见不得人)的任务。而一些安全软件,如360等,会有结束进程的功能,如果不做Service的保持,就会被其杀掉。 在早...
分类:
移动开发 时间:
2014-11-10 12:17:08
阅读次数:
219
就在不久前的刚刚,部分微信用户反映在使用微信时,出现退出后无法登陆的情况。微信团队在官方微博上确认了此事,并发公告正在紧急抢救。 据了解,今日下午14时许,微信用户陆续发现微信退出不能登陆故障。15时左右,微信提示,“微信功能故障,部分功能暂不可用,正在修复中,请稍后再试”。据悉,已经登录的用...
分类:
微信 时间:
2014-11-07 16:52:42
阅读次数:
361